Genney forum
Synpunkter => Tekniska problem och förslag => Ämnet startat av: chrede skrivet 2015-08-13, 07:47:21 AM
-
Hej,
Genny känns riktigt bra att jobba med, men ett par hinder för att byta finns för mitt vidkommande.
I Disgen som jag kört i alla år, finns dels en funktion för registrering av faddrar, och som alla släktforskare vet är det ofta en bra och viktig hjälp att fastställa släktrelationer med.
Systemet med "flaggor" i Disgen har jag mycket stor nytta av, lätt och snabbt att vid sökning ex vis sortera ut soldater från ett visst kompani, yrken eller vad man vill.
Bekymret är givetvis nu att detta inte följer med vid en import och att det handlar om en databas med ca 17.000 individer, uppbyggd under ett antal år. Importen i övrigt fungerar alldeles strålande, men det känns inte så lockande att manuellt återskapa alla dessa kopplingar.
Någon som har en bra idé hur det kan lösas?
-
Faddrar går inte att exportera från Disgen vad jag vet.
Om man ska lägga till faddrar i Genny så gör man det naturligast i källan som är kopplad till födelsen. Det möjliggör då också att man får med sig allt enl. gedcom-standard vid export.
Flaggor är jag osäker på men tror inte de heller exporteras men ska kolla om några dar då jag har möjlighet.
Grupper i Genny erbjuder väl något liknande som flaggor där du efter hand kan lägga folk i grupper efter att du t.ex. sökt efter en viss sorts soldater.
-
Jag skriver in faddrarna som en notering till födelsen, se bifogad bild.
Jag har ofta skrivit exakt vad som står i födelseboken (det som har gått att läsa)
Förklaring av för förkortningar:
Sucs = Susceptor = gudmor
Test = Testes = faddrar
[bifogad fil raderad av administratör]
-
Att redovisa faddrar i Genny är säkert inga problem, och likaså att skapa grupper istället för Disgens flaggor för samma syfte. Programmet verkar vara mycket väl genomtänkt för att kunna bygga upp sådana funktioner.
Ditt sätt att hantera faddrar är mycket förtänksamt BengtDNilsson, men nu hade ju Disgen detta som en separat funktion och dessutom sökbar, så nu sitter man där :)
Importproblem av detta slag finns ju mellan de flesta program och är fullt förståeligt, men, problemställningen var egentligen: Hur få med sig all denna information utan att behöva göra en oerhörd massa dubbelarbete?
I mitt fall handlar det ju om ett antal tusen flaggmarkeringar, och ännu fler faddernotiser och jag är väl knappast ensam om problematiken.
Jag är medveten om att det troligen inte finns någon lösning, men kanske, kanske någon har hittat en väg, genom någon proffsig bearbetning/redigering av GEDCOM-filen ex vis?
-
Vi provade ett program för en längre tid sedan, kommer inte ihåg vilket, men den la alla gedcomtaggar den inte kunde behandla eller kände igen i noteringar om personen.
-
Eftersom informationen om faddrarna inte går att få med i gedcom exporten från Disgen i nuläget ser jag ingen annan lösning än att försöka förmå Disgen att införa det, exempelvis genom att exportera det som notering till händelsen.
-
Tyvärr kommer fadderfunktionen nu att försvinna i nya Disgen 2015, och faddrarna omskapas till enskilda personer som man sedan manuellt får koppla till resp händelse (dop).
Att då Disgen skulle införa detta nu blir nog tyvärr en utopi fast det hade behövts inom Disgen? Problemet kommer ju att uppstå även där. Personerna finns kvar, men kopplingarna försvinner, plus att mängder av dubbletter då uppstår.
Nå, nu snackar vi export till Genny. Hoppas Du kommer ihåg vilket program det var, Kerranofredde, för det låter ju som en helt rimlig och möjlig lösning att bibehålla kopplingarna..
För mitt vidkommande kommer jag att fortsätta med Genny, eftersom jag mer och mer ser vilken stor potential det finns och då får det överväga importbekymren.
-
Jag laddade ned Disgen demo och testade lite.
1.
Filen med flaggornas betydelser finns i här (på datorn med Windows 7):
C:\Users\Public\Documents\Dg82Data\DgCommon\Flags.ini
2.
Jag exporterade till gedcom-fil och där saknades som bekant flaggor och faddrar.
3.
Jag exporterade till text-fil och där fanns
personens id (rader som börjar på M eller K).
flaggor (rader som börjar med H)
faddrar (rader som börjar med f)
Om man valt fadderns församling från Disgens lista så är tyvärr församlingen kodad och jag har inte lyckats knäcka den koden.
4.
Jag exporterade till HTML-fil och namnet på person-filerna var personens id.
Där fanns faddrarna med sin församling i klartext.
ÅÄÖ är kodat i enligt html-standarden och behöver konverteras tillbaka.
Om man exporterar många personer (jag hade två) kommer Disgen troligen att skapa många undermappar (för att inte få för många filer i en mapp).
5.
Det borde gå att skapa en "Sammanslagningsfunktion" som utökar gedcom-filen med lite information från text-filen (flaggor) och html-filerna (faddrar).
-
Det låter intressant och värt att jobba lite med, många timmar att vinna. Jag skall pyssla lite med detta och återkommer.
-
Jag har tänkt att skriva ett litet program som fixar till gedcom-filen, men du får gärna göra det...
-
Hrmmm.... BengtD, be my guest..., mina kunskaper i programmering är inte ens vad de aldrig varit... :-[
Jag tänkte närmast att kolla igenom om det fanns något på nätet som kunde vara till hjälp... Behöver Du beta-testare?
-
Chrede,
Kan du göra följande på din dator i Disgen?
1. Välj i menyn i Disgen: Verktyg - Exportera personer - Exportera till HTML
2. Välj ett mapp för html-filen och klicka på Nästa
3. Kryssa för "Ansedlar för valda personer" och klicka på Nästa
4. Välj mallen "Disgen10" och klicka på Nästa
5. Ändra antal generationer bakåt till 1
6. Klicka på knappen Ändra vid Notiser för huvudpersonen och kryssa för allt
7. Klicka på Nästa många gånger
8. Klicka på Exportera
9. Klicka på "Alla inmatade personer"
När jag testar ovanstående på min dator med Windows 7 placeras resultatet i följande mapp:
C:\Users\Public\Documents\Dg82Data\Html
Jag skulle gärna vilja får reda på hur dina html-filer blir placerade i mapp-strukturen (när man har många personer i Disgen).
Om du har Windows 7:
Klicka på Start-knappen nere till vänster på skärmen och skriv CMD och tryck på Enter (öppnar ett svart kommando-fönster)
Skriv följande i fönstret och tryck på Enter efter varje rad
CD C:\Users\Public\Documents\Dg82Data\Html
DIR /S >lista.txt
Detta skapar filen lista.txt som innehåller namnen på alla mappar och filer som Disgen skapat vid html-exporten.
Den filen skulle du gärna få ladda upp här till forumet.
-
Hej,
är på väg till ett styrelsemöte men skall försöka fixa detta redan ikväll, hör av mig!
-
Jämra styrelsemöte höll på i 3 timmar mot normalt 1, men fixar detta så snart jag kan och levererar, sorry!
Har pysslat med datorer sedan Amigans tid, och från Win 3.1 så kommandotolken inget problem ;), kräver kanske bara lite uppfräschning av de gamla kunskaperna.
-
Nå, nu blev det gjort, men listan blev för stor att lägga upp här, 1 121 kB...
Mejla Dig den?